If Three Way was riding high fresh off their 72-42 takedown of Ranger last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. Three Way came up short against the Walnut Springs Hornets on Friday, falling 52-27. Three Way was not able to make up for their defeat to Walnut Springs from their previous meeting back in November of 2018.
Three Way has traveled a rocky road recently having lost five of their last six cont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 6-10 record this season. As for Walnut Springs, the win snapped their losing streak at four games and leaves them with a 8-9 record.
Coincidentally, the two teams will both be playing Iredell the next time they take the court. Three Way will host Iredell at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day, while Walnut Springs will head out to face them at 7:30 p.m. on January 17th.
